ASoC: au1x: PSC-AC97 bugfixes



This patch fixes the following bugs:

- only reprogram bitdepth if it has changed since last call to hw_params.
- add locking inside ac97_read/write functions:
  When reprogramming sample depth, the ac97 unit has to be disabled,
  which should not be done in the middle of codec register accesses.

- retry timed-out codec register accesses.

- wait for status bits to set/clear when starting/stopping various
  functional blocks; very important after reenabling AC97 unit else
  sound may be distorted (e.g. high-pitch noise in 1kHz sine wave).

- clear fifos before/after starting/stopping RX/TX.

- longer timeouts waiting for PSC/AC97 ready after cold reset
  with certain codecs this can take ridiculous amounts of time.

Run-tested on various Au1200 platforms with various codecs.
